    INFJ Life Coach Lesson: As an INFJ, it’s common to feel underestimated or like people don’t recognize your true strength. But what if I told you that your quiet intensity is exactly what makes you unforgettable? In this video, we’ll explore how to lean into that power and use it to your advantage.
    You’ll learn how to command energy in any room, stop diminishing yourself to make others feel good, and allow your presence to speak for itself. This isn’t about pretending to be someone else-it’s about fully embracing who you already are.
